The Organisation The Housing Industry Association (HIA) is the official body of Australia’s home building industry. As the national industry association for Australian building professionals, we represent the interests of the housing industry at regional and national levels. We have proudly been representing the Australian housing industry for 80 years. Our vision remains the same, to be an association that speaks with a united voice on industry issues and creates real change, providing quality services at the lowest cost and working with the sector to maintain high standards. Overview The Customer Service Coordinator (CSC) - Student Management is primarily responsible for the compliant and supportive registration, progression and completion of students across a designated region by providing a high level of customer service and support mechanisms to ensure quality outcomes and KPI’s are achieved. The Customer Service Coordinator - Student Management ensures all students are provided the training and support to progress at required milestones and complete training within allocated timeframes. The CSC will work closely with HIA team members to ensure quality, compliant management of a designated but flexible student caseload.
